Philadelphia Streets Department Continues Snow Removal Efforts ⁣in⁤ Center City

Crews ⁤in Center City Philadelphia⁤ are continuing to clear ice and snow following the winter⁤ storm that impacted⁣ the region over the weekend. As of January⁣ 28, 2026, the city has ⁣completed its emergency⁤ declaration, but ⁤ongoing operations are focused on removing accumulated snow from key areas.

Snow Removal operations⁢ in Center City

On January 27, 2026, the Philadelphia Streets Department initiated ‍a “Lifting‍ operation” to remove snow⁣ around City Hall. ⁢This involved a concentrated effort to clear roadways and sidewalks in the downtown core.

The following streets were ⁢closed ⁢between 4:00 PM ⁣and midnight on ⁣Tuesday, January 27th,⁣ to facilitate snow removal:

  • Penn square around City Hall
  • North Broad Street from Arch Street to City Hall
  • South Broad Street from Chestnut Street to ⁤City Hall
  • 15th‍ Street from Arch⁣ Street to Chestnut Street
  • JFK Boulevard from Filbert Street to 16th Street
  • East Market Street from 13th Street to City Hall
  • West Market Street from 16th Street to City Hall

According to ⁢the⁤ Streets Department, crews had been working ⁢in North Philadelphia for the‍ previous⁢ two days, removing snow⁤ from Girard Avenue and surrounding neighborhoods sence Sunday⁣ night. ⁤Similar removal operations have been carried out in various ⁢neighborhoods throughout the city.

Resources Deployed

The⁢ snow removal operation involves ‍dozens of⁢ specialized ‍units, including heavy machinery, excavators, and loaders. The Philadelphia Streets⁤ department website provides updates on snow⁣ emergencies⁤ and removal efforts.

Residents are advised ⁢to avoid unneeded travel. If driving is essential, they are urged to allow extra‍ time, drive cautiously, and give ⁤snow removal crews ample space to operate safely.
